QML型別說明 ConicalGradient

2021-06-25 08:37:01 字數 2409 閱讀 6068

conicalgradient

importstatement:   import qtgraphicaleffects 1.0

since:  qtgraphicaleffects 1.0

inherits:      item

properties

angle : real

cached :bool

gradient :gradient

horizontaloffset: real

source :variant

verticaloffset: real

detaileddescription

漸變定義了兩個或兩個以上的顏色的五縫混合。顏色從指定的角度開始,結束於比指定角度大360的位置。

下面是**:

importqtquick 2.0

importqtgraphicaleffects 1.0

item

gradientstop }}

}propertydocumentation

angle : real

漸變開始的位置,在梯度位置0.0的顏色被渲染。梯度位置和角度大小成正比。角度值順時針增加。

角度的影響

angle: 0

angle: 45

angle: 185

horizontaloffset: 0

horizontaloffset: 0

horizontaloffset: 0

verticaloffset: 0

verticaloffset: 0

verticaloffset: 0

cached :bool

gradient :gradient

漸變定義了兩個或兩個以上的顏色被無縫連線。它使用gradientstop子元件指明色彩。每個gradientstop有2個屬性,position屬性為gradientstop的位置,值為0.0到1.0之間,color屬性指明gradientstop的顏色。

漸變的影響

gradient:

gradient 

gradientstop

gradientstop

gradientstop

gradientstop

gradientstop

gradientstop

}

gradient:

gradient 

gradientstop

gradientstop

}

gradient:

gradient 

gradientstop

}

angle: 0

angle: 0

angle: 0

horizontaloffset: 0

horizontaloffset: 0

horizontaloffset: 0

verticaloffset: 0

verticaloffset: 0

verticaloffset: 0

horizontaloffset: real

horizontaloffset和verticaloffset是錐形中心點的水平和垂直偏移的畫素數。中心點垂直朝上,產生的線,是0度角線。它的值預設為0。影響如下:

水平偏移的影響

horizontaloffset: -50

horizontaloffset: 0

horizontaloffset: 50

angle: 0

angle: 0

angle: 0

verticaloffset: 0

verticaloffset: 0

verticaloffset: 0

source :variant

漸變填充在**。源是渲染的中間緩衝區,它的alpha值決定了漸變的可見性。預設值是undefined。表示填充整個區域。下表未指定蝴蝶的源,這可能是英文文件的缺陷。修復我。

源的影響

source: undefined

source:

angle: 0

angle: 0

horizontaloffset: 0

horizontaloffset: 0

verticaloffset: 0

verticaloffset: 0

注意,讓自身成為源是不支援的。所以在例項中不能設定父為source。

verticaloffset: real

horizontaloffset和verticaloffset是錐形中心點的水平和垂直偏移的畫素數。中心點垂直朝上,產生的線,是0度角線。它的值預設為0。原英文示例是錯誤的。這裡將之省略。

QML型別說明 AnimatedSprite

animatedsprite importstatement import qtquick2.2 inherits item properties currentframe int framecount int frameduration int frameheight int framerate ...

QML型別說明 AudioSample

audiosample importstatement import qtaudioengine1.0 since qt 5.0 inherits item properties loaded bool name string preloaded bool signals loadedchanged...

QML型別說明 BluetoothService

bluetoothservice importstatement import qtbluetooth 5.2 since qt 5.2 properties deviceaddress string devicename string registered string servicedescri...